A 10 panel drug test stands as one of the most comprehensive options available for drug screening. Unlike the standard 5 panel test, this expanded version is designed to detect a wider array of substances. It includes common drugs such as marijuana, cocaine, opiates, amphetamines, and PCP. However, it extends its coverage to also screen for benzodiazepines, barbiturates, methadone, propoxyphene, and Quaaludes (methaqualone).

This extensive range makes the 10 panel drug test an invaluable tool for identifying both common and less frequently abused substances. At-a-Glance

Both options screen the same 10 drug classes (THC, cocaine, opiates, amphetamines/methamphetamine, PCP, benzodiazepines, barbiturates, methadone, propoxyphene, and Quaaludes*). The difference is how results are produced, verified, and used.

*Methaqualone only available in urine lab-based testing

10 Panel Lab based vs. 10 Panel Instant Drug Test

Feature 10 Panel Lab-Based 10 Panel Instant (POCT)
Primary Use Employment, legal/court, policy-driven programs Rapid on-site screening; same-day hiring decisions
Specimen Urine (standard); hair/oral fluid/nail options Urine (most common)
Speed Negatives 1 business day after lab receipt; non-negatives 2-3 days with MRO Screen results in 5-10 minutes (presumptive)
Accuracy & Confirmation High; confirmatory GC/MS or LC-MS/MS on any non-negative Screening only; non-negatives should be lab-confirmed
MRO Review Yes (on non-negative lab results) Not by default; added when sending to lab
Chain of Custody (CCF) End-to-end documented Used for screen; lab CCF applies if sent for confirmation
Legal Defensibility Strong (SAMHSA-certified lab + confirmation + MRO) Limited until confirmed by a lab
Compliance Meets most employer/court policies; DOT uses lab-based 5-panel Great for rapid screens; policies often require confirmation for final action
Cost Profile Higher unit price; includes confirmation/MRO when needed Lower upfront; confirmation adds cost/time on non-negatives

10 Panel Drug Test Detection Times

Windows are driven by drug metabolism and specimen type, not whether testing is lab-based or instant. Urine is standard for both; alternative specimens are typically lab-based.

Specimen Typical Detection Window Best Use
Urine 1-7 days (THC up to 30) Employment, legal, personal
Hair Up to 90 days History/patterns of use
Oral Fluid (Saliva) 24-72 hours Recent use; post-accident/suspicion
Blood Hours to 2-3 days Very recent use
Nails 3-6 months Extended look-back

Compliance Notes

  • DOT programs require a lab-based 5-panel under 49 CFR Part 40 (not a 10 panel).
  • Many employer/court policies require lab confirmation + MRO review for final actions.
  • On-site instant testing may require appropriate CLIA credentials depending on device and state rules.

What Does a 10 Panel Drug Test Detect?

  • Marijuana (THC)
  • Cocaine
  • Opiates (morphine, codeine, heroin)
  • Amphetamines (incl. methamphetamine)
  • Phencyclidine (PCP)
  • Benzodiazepines
  • Barbiturates
  • Methadone
  • Propoxyphene
  • Quaaludes (methaqualone) (available in lab-based testing only)

How It Works

  1. Order: Online or by phone; select location and donor details.
  2. Collection: Visit a nearby site with a valid photo ID.
  3. Lab Analysis: Immunoassay screen with GC/MS or LC-MS/MS confirmation when needed.
  4. Results: Negatives within 1 business day; non-negatives 2-3 business days after MRO review.

10 Panel Drug Testing in Tehuacana, TX

Tehuacana, Texas, is a small town with a unique charm, located in Limestone County. Known for its rich history and close-knit community, this rural area offers a peaceful lifestyle with a hint of nostalgia. The town is a quaint reflection of traditional Texan values, enriched with a friendly atmosphere.

Historically significant, Tehuacana once housed Tehuacana Academy and later Westminster College, which greatly influenced its development. Though these institutions are no longer operational, the town retains an educational legacy that locals hold in high regard.

The population of Tehuacana is small, embodying the essence of a tight-knit community. Residents share a strong sense of belonging, often coming together for town events and communal activities that highlight their friendly spirit.

Economically, Tehuacana relies heavily on local businesses and agricultural activities. Neighboring towns and cities provide additional employment opportunities, with residents often commuting for work while enjoying the tranquility of rural life at home.

Demographically, Tehuacana features a diverse mix of age groups, with a notable percentage of families and retirees. This balance lends stability to the community, with education and family life being central to the local culture.

Outdoor enthusiasts can explore the natural beauty surrounding Tehuacana, with several parks and recreational areas nearby. These spaces provide opportunities for hiking, picnicking, and enjoying the great Texas outdoors.

Overall, Tehuacana, Texas, is a blend of history, community, and simplicity, offering residents and visitors alike a form of rural retreat with all the comforts of small-town living.
